Is Viva Naturals Elderberry with Vitamin C Zinc a good supplement?

Viva Naturals Elderberry with Vitamin C Zinc received a product quality score of 69/100 in GoodSupp's independent analysis, suggesting some areas that could be improved. The product contains 4 active ingredients with 120 servings per container. The manufacturer, Viva Naturals, holds a brand trust score of 86/100 with 7 verified certifications including Consumerlab, Labdoor, Fda Gmp Inspections, Gluten Free Gfco.

What are the ingredients in Viva Naturals Elderberry with Vitamin C Zinc?

Viva Naturals Elderberry with Vitamin C Zinc contains 4 active ingredients: Black Elderberry (1000 mg), Vitamin C (400 mg), Zinc (10 mg), Ginger (300 mg). Each ingredient's dosage, form, and safety rating is analyzed independently in GoodSupp's full product breakdown.

Is Viva Naturals a trustworthy supplement brand?

Viva Naturals receives a brand trust score of 86/100 based on GoodSupp's independent analysis of certifications, regulatory history, and transparency practices. Founded in 2014 and headquartered in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, the company offers 16 products in their lineup. They hold 7 verified certifications including Consumerlab, Labdoor, Fda Gmp Inspections, Gluten Free Gfco. Third-party certifications are independently verified and indicate the brand meets specific quality, purity, and manufacturing standards. Note: Viva Naturals has 2 historical regulatory incidents on record, which are factored into the trust score.

How much magnesium per day?

The optimal dosage depends on your individual health needs, age, sex, and current nutrient levels. Recommended daily amounts are established by health authorities but may vary from therapeutic doses used in clinical research. It's important to check the Supplement Facts label for the exact amount per serving and compare it against the % Daily Value. Some supplements provide mega-doses well above the Daily Value, which may not be necessary and in some cases could be harmful — particularly for f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, K) that accumulate in the body.
